Output 080506c51d41a0b9768eeb67b812fd6fd2dade07b7d9132da5d22fb3ef576e26:2

value
21196934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6659ce78a68c087a45aad7686019e0fee90efe7 OP_EQUAL
address
MRzBkbpoiNxzpfFbxGpgb4h6b6o3ci5W2y
transaction
080506c51d41a0b9768eeb67b812fd6fd2dade07b7d9132da5d22fb3ef576e26
spent
true